A mir. _glum of two acres of open <br />pasture must be available for a single horse and one <br />additional acre must be available for each additional horse. <br />When the horses are kept stabled and do not require pasture <br />for feed purposes, the m4nimuin pasture requirement may be <br />adjusted at the discretion of the Council. Such minimum <br />pasture acreage shall not include low lying lands unusable <br />for pasture or grazing. Stables and Barns - Private. The use of an <br />accessory building for keeping animals for non-commercial <br />purposes provided it is for the non-commercial use of the <br />property owner or resident and meets the available area <br />standards outlined in paragraph M of this subsection. <br />Further, no such structure shall be closer than 150 feet to <br />the nearest adjacent residence and no closer than .75 feet <br />from the nearest lot 1_ ine . <br />0.
